Recurring event
Fluorescents
The Lower Third26 Denmark Street, London, WC2H 8NJ
Free
About this event
*For accessibility information please see the accessibility information button/link below.* Presented by UPGRADE This is an 16+ event
*For accessibility information please see the accessibility information button/link below.* Presented by UPGRADE This is an 16+ event